Pillar of Mist

1987 South Korean film


Pillar of Mist (Korean: 안개기둥; RR: Angae Gidung) is a 1987 South Korean film directed by Park Chul-soo. It was chosen as Best Film at the Grand Bell Awards.[2][3][1]

Quick Facts Pillar of Mist, Hangul ...

Plot

The film is a drama about a married couple.[1]
